Xboard menu fonts

 I described the problem here in my last post. I understand that it is an old issue but is there any way to make menu fonts in xboard like in others applications installed in the system(f.e. in Gnome)?
this is Debian wheezy 32 bit Gnome 3 with gnome-shell, xboard 4.6.2-1

Tim Mann | 1 Jul 2012 00:16

Re: Xboard menu fonts

xboard uses the old Xaw widget set, which can only use the original kind of X font, not the newer kind that Gnome, etc. use. So your choices are limited. The fonts you like are probably all the newer kind.

There was a project to convert xboard from Xaw to GTK, but it seems to have stalled.
